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ance. Other than that, Passmark measures multi-core performance.

Xeon Gold 5122 8875
+168%
Samples: 37
FX-9830P 3306
Samples: 175

Pros & cons summary


Performance score 5.07 1.89
Recency 25 April 2017 31 May 2016
Threads 8 4
Chip lithography 14 nm 28 nm
Power consumption (TDP) 105 Watt 35 Watt

Xeon Gold 5122 has a 168% higher aggregate performance score, an age advantage of 10 months, 100% more threads, and a 100% more advanced lithography process.

FX-9830P, on the other hand, has 200% lower power consumption.

The Intel Xeon Gold 5122 is our recommended choice as it beats the AMD FX-9830P in performance tests.

Be aware that Xeon Gold 5122 is a server/workstation processor while FX-9830P is a notebook one.
